Property Description
Nestled in the historic district of Washington, Virginia, the circa 1930 Craftsman-style bungalow offers vintage charm and modern convenience. A deep front porch welcomes you home, while original hardwood floors flow through the main part of the house. A light-filled addition expands the living space as a relaxing family room leading to the screened-in porch. A main level-primary bedroom is adjacent to the full bathroom. Upstairs, there are three more bedrooms and an additional full bath. The unfinished walkout basement offers opportunities to expand the living area as well. The property also benefits from town water and sewer services, plus the availability of high-speed Comcast internet.
